1,下載mongodb安裝包,官方網站:https://www.mongodb.com/download-centernode
2,經過tar -xzvf mongodb-linux-x86_64-rhel70-3.4.10.tgz -C apache,並在安裝目錄建立data目錄,以及logs目錄和logs/mongodb.log文件linux
3,使用vim在mongodb的bin目錄建立mongodb.conf配置文件,文件內容以下:mongodb
storage:apache
dbPath:"/usr/local/apache/mongodb/data"vim
systemLog:centos
destination:file網站
path:"/usr/local/apache/mongodb/logs/mongodb.log"spa
net:ssl
port:27017openssl
http:
RESTInterfaceEnabled:true
processManagement:
fork:false
4,nohup ./mongod -f mongodb.conf & 啓動mongodb
5,若是沒法啓動,報./mongod: relocation error: ./mongod: symbol TLSv1_2_client_method, version libssl.so.10 not defined錯誤,就是centos系統openssl版本過低了
rpm -qa | grep openssl查看系統openssl
rpm -e openssl-1.0.0-27.el6.i686 openssl-1.0.0-27.el6.x86_64 --nodeps 刪除低版本openssl
rpm -ivh openssl-1.0.1e-57.el6.x86_64.rpm --nodeps 安裝新版本openssl
6,下載openssl :https://pkgs.org/download/openssl,安裝新版本openssl,再啓動mongodb,就ok了